Output ec5de51e5ef6c33684a1a5ae2015f6ca6902aaad95900a756db16d3a4750dff4:0

value
450546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6164e2e9fc71c223fa553766ab40a4ca144934 OP_EQUAL
address
3PWk6T7bbvw5Jv8cb793Hd77LM84Kqexxh
transaction
ec5de51e5ef6c33684a1a5ae2015f6ca6902aaad95900a756db16d3a4750dff4
confirmations
100633
spent
true